## Break-Glass: Bramblewick Scanner Integration

Quick note for security review: if the Bramblewick barcode scanner bridge loses its token and warehouse intake stalls, on-call can break glass rather than wait for IT. It's audited, time-boxed to two hours, and auto-revokes. To open the emergency console on the intake kiosk, enter the recovery passphrase printed below.

vault phrase of hawif-bahof = novvan-belius-istael-fenvan-holdor-druox-eliath

Subject: Flaglet rollout framework — integration notes

Team,

Flaglet v3 is live in the Dorvane staging mesh. Partner flags now evaluate server-side; client SDKs only cache. Migrate your gate checks to the new evaluate endpoint before the freeze. Percentage rollouts are config-driven, no redeploys. Docs live in the Flaglet handbook; keep them current for whoever inherits this. Staging calls must authenticate with the token below.

— Merrit, Platform

login token, bagug-kafop: eyJhbGciOiJIUzI1NiIsInR5cCI6IkpXVCJ9.eyJzdWIiOiIcMLov2In0.Z5RLDIfp

Quick note on the Fernwold engagement: their team finished the image slimming pass for the Quillbase services, and the results are solid — base images down from 1.4 GB to about 210 MB, cold starts noticeably faster in staging. Contract-wise we're still inside the original scope, so no change order needed. They've asked us to flag any regressions before the Harrowgate release cut. If anything looks off with the slimmed images, drop their delivery lead a line.

escalation mailbox, bafog-fafog: ulador@paliqlabs.internal

**Capacity note — SpoolJet**

Heads up for the Q3 cut: SpoolJet's queue depth spikes hard during the Monday print storms, and the worker pool isn't keeping up. We bumped concurrency and trimmed the retry backoff so stale jobs drain faster. Nothing scary, just arithmetic. The tuning constants we settled on are below.

tuning table, hadug-hahig:
QUOTAS = {
    "quenath": 10,
    "zorath": 10,
}